区块链钱包与身份的关系:安全、隐私与去中心

### 引言 在数字化时代,区块链技术以其去中心化、安全性和透明性逐渐在各个领域崭露头角。其中,区块链钱包作为用户与数字资产交互的工具,其与身份的关系愈发受到关注。随着越来越多的服务与身份管理需求转向数字化,区块链钱包不仅是资产存储的工具,更成为了身份认同和验证的重要载体。本文将探讨区块链钱包与身份的关系,分析其在安全性、隐私性和去中心化方面的优势,以及未来可能的发展方向和挑战。 ### 区块链钱包的基本概念 区块链钱包是一个用于存储、发送和接收数字资产的数字工具。传统的钱包存储的是货币,而区块链钱包则存储的是私钥,用于访问和管理存储在区块链上的数字资产。区块链钱包有多种类型,包括热钱包、冷钱包和硬件钱包等,每种类型的安全性和便捷性各有优劣。 #### 热钱包与冷钱包的比较 热钱包是连接互联网的钱包,适合频繁交易的用户,但相对来说安全性较低,因为它们容易遭受黑客攻击。冷钱包则是离线保存的解决方案,安全性高,适合长期存储资产。但使用上不如热钱包方便。 ### 区块链钱包与身份的关系 在探索区块链钱包与身份的关系时,必须从去中心化身份管理这个角度入手。传统身份验证通常依赖于中心化的机构,如银行、政府或社交网络,这些机构控制着用户的身份数据,用户对这些数据几乎没有掌控权。而在区块链的世界中,用户可以通过钱包管理自己的身份信息。 #### 去中心化身份的优势 去中心化身份管理的一个主要优势是用户掌控自己的数据。传统的身份验证流程往往需要用户频繁提交和验证个人信息,而在区块链上,用户可以一次性上传数据,后续的应用只需要访问并验证这些信息,而无需再次提供。通过这种方式,用户可以有效降低个人信息被滥用的风险。 ### 如何使用区块链钱包进行身份验证 区块链钱包运作的核心在于私钥和公钥的结合。用户通过私钥进行身份验证,而公钥则用于在线交易和身份的确认。当一个用户创建钱包时,系统会生成一对密钥——公钥和私钥。用户可以通过公钥与他人分享身份信息,而私钥则必须严格保管,确保没有其他人能访问用户的资产和信息。 #### 智能合约与身份管理 智能合约是一种自执行的合约,合约条款被直接写入代码中。通过智能合约,用户可以设置特定的条件来控制身份信息的分享和使用。例如,某个用户可以规定只有在满足特定条件下,某个服务商才能访问特定的身份信息。这种方式不仅提高了数据的安全性,还赋予用户对自身数据的更大掌控权。 ### 区块链钱包与身份的现实应用案例 在现实中,区块链钱包与身份管理的结合已经逐渐开始落地。许多企业和项目已经开始探索这一领域,推动去中心化身份的应用。 #### 案例一:uPort uPort是一个去中心化身份管理平台,允许用户创建和管理自己的身份。用户可以通过uPort钱包存储个人信息,并根据需要分享给各种服务和应用。uPort通过区块链保存用户的身份信息,保证信息的安全和隐私。 #### 案例二:SelfKey SelfKey是一个去中心化身份系统,用户可以持有自己的身份钱包,并将身份信息存储在区块链上。用户可以利用SelfKey钱包进行身份验证,享受更大的隐私保护和数据控制。 ### 区块链钱包在身份管理中面临的挑战 虽然区块链钱包与身份管理之间的结合展现出巨大的潜力,但在实际运行中仍面临许多挑战。 #### 数据隐私和安全 尽管区块链提供暗号学保障,但数据隐私仍然是一个重要问题。用户在使用区块链钱包时,如何确保自己的身份信息不会泄漏给非授权者,是一个需要重点关注的问题。此外,用户的私钥一旦丢失,资产将永久无法恢复,这也使得安全性问题显得更加重要。 #### 法规与合规性 随着区块链技术的发展,各国政府对数字资产和身份管理的法律法规也在逐渐完善。这些法规可能影响区块链钱包的使用及其与身份管理的结合。因此,在设计区块链钱包与身份管理系统时,确保合规性也是面临的一大挑战。 ### 未来的发展方向 随着技术的发展和越来越多的企业开始认识到去中心化身份的潜力,区块链钱包与身份管理的结合将会迎来更广阔的发展前景。 #### 进化的身份解决方案 未来,区块链钱包将不仅仅局限于数字资产的管理,还将承载用户的多维度身份信息。例如,医疗记录、教育背景等,都会以去中心化的形式存在于区块链网络上,用户能够根据需要去授权使用。 #### 人工智能的结合 人工智能技术可以与区块链钱包结合,为身份管理提供更智能的解决方案。通过机器学习,AI可以帮助用户识别潜在的身份盗窃或欺诈行为,从而提高区块链钱包在身份管理方面的安全性。 ### 可能相关的问题 #### 区块链如何防止身份盗用? 区块链通过去中心化特性和强大的加密技术,有效降低了身份盗用的风险。不过,用户在使用区块链钱包时仍需谨慎保管私钥,以防泄漏。 #### 如何确保个人数据的隐私? 区块链钱包利用加密算法管理用户身份信息,用户可以选择分享特定的信息,这样可以保护个人数据的隐私。 #### 区块链钱包的适用场景有哪些? 区块链钱包适用于多种场景,比如金融交易、电子商务、身份验证等,在身份管理中尤为突出。 #### 未来区块链钱包将在身份管理中扮演什么角色? 未来,区块链钱包将成为数字身份的主要载体,用户将能存储和管理更全面的身份信息,并在各类服务中灵活使用。 ### 结论 区块链钱包与身份的关系正日益紧密,去中心化的身份管理不仅解决了传统身份验证中的许多问题,还为用户提供了控制自身数据的新方式。尽管面临挑战,但随着技术的进步,区块链钱包将在未来承担更加重要的角色,为用户提供更为安全和便捷的数字身份管理解决方案。